حَدَّثَنَا حَسَنٌ حَدَّثَنَا شَيْبَانُ عَنْ لَيْثٍ عَنْ طَاوُسٍ عَنِ ابْنِ عَبَّاسٍ أَنَّهُ قَالَ لَمَّا حُضِرَ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 قَالَ ائْتُونِي بِكَتِفٍ أَكْتُبْ لَكُمْ فِيهِ كِتَابًا لَا يَخْتَلِفُ مِنْكُمْ رَجُلَانِ بَعْدِي قَالَ فَأَقْبَلَ الْقَوْمُ فِي لَغَطِهِمْ فَقَالَتْ الْمَرْأَةُ وَيْحَكُمْ عَهْدُ رَسُولِ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
مسند امام احمد بن حنبل · Hadith 2676
It was narrated that Ibn 'Abbas (RA) said: When the Messenge of Allah (PBUH) was dying, he said: "Bring me a shoulder blade [of an animal] so that I may write a document for you, then no two men among you will disagree after I am gone." The people started debating and the woman said: Woe to you, the covenant of the Messenger of Allah (PBUH).”
